How to Write 31 in Words – Step-by-Step Method

Let's break down the process of converting 31 into words:

1. Start with 31, which is made up of digits "3" and "1".

2. In the place value system, "3" is in the tens place, "1" is in the ones place.

3. 3 × Ten = 30

4. 1 × One = 1

5. 30 + 1 = 31

6. Write "Thirty" for 30 and "one" for 1.

7. Join with a hyphen: Thirty-one.

So, 31 in words is written as Thirty-one.

Ordinal and Larger Forms of 31

Sometimes, you may need to write the ordinal or thousand form:

31st in words: Thirty-first

31,000 in words: Thirty-one thousand

These forms are useful in dates (like “31st December”) or writing big numbers in words for maths problems.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Spelling "Thirty one" without a hyphen (should be "Thirty-one")
  • Mixing up 31 (Thirty-one) and 13 (Thirteen)
  • Writing 31st as "Thirty-oneth" instead of "Thirty-first"

9. Why is “Thirty-one” hyphenated in English?

The hyphen in Thirty-one follows English grammar rules for writing compound numbers between 21 and 99. Hyphenation combines the tens and unit place words to form a single number name, improving readability and clarity.

12. How can number names help avoid errors in cheques and forms?

Writing number names on cheques and forms is essential to prevent mistakes or fraud. If digits are incorrectly written or altered, the number in words serves as a backup reference, ensuring the intended amount is clear and legally valid.
